Why Calculating Your Gas Mix is Crucial

Nitrox diving isn’t just an advanced level-up; it requires an understanding of your dive profile. An optimal gas mix ensures that you're keeping your oxygen levels efficient while balancing out nitrogen limits. It’s all about allowing you to stay longer below the surface. With the right mix, you can maximize your bottom time without compromising safety.

For example, did you know that a higher oxygen percentage affects your maximum operational depth? It’s true! Too much depth on a high-oxygen mix can lead to dangerous situations. That’s why when crafting your nitrox diving plan, you have to think about:
